Dividend stock to buy: Waste Management

Waste Management $WM is one of the most reliable dividend stocks due to its stability and recession-resistance. As the largest provider of waste management services in North America, it benefits from high barriers to entry for competitors and continued demand for its services.

Why invest in Waste Management?

A resilient business model

- Waste management is a necessary service, even in a recession - garbage simply has to be collected.

-$WM has an extensive network of landfills and transfer stations in the US and Canada.

- High regulatory barriers and resistance to new landfills protect its market share.

Growth potential

-Growing population and economy means more waste → more revenue for $WM.

- Strategic acquisitions support expansion:

- The recent $7.2 billion purchase of Stericycle expanded its services to include medical waste disposal.

Strong dividend history

-22 years of continuous dividend increases makes $WM a reliable dividend stock.

- Current dividend yield: 1.5%, which, while lower than some other dividend stocks, is offset by stability and long-term dividend growth.

Cash flow generation

- Acquisitions and effective management of operating expenses allow for increased cash flow, which supports further dividend increases.

Summary

Waste Management $WM is one of the most stable dividend stocks with a resilient business, growing demand and a strong history of dividend payouts. Through expansion and acquisitions, it has the potential to continue to increase dividends, making it an attractive option for long-term investors looking for stable income.
